1. Master the Mirror Glaze Heart Cake

Ruby Red Heart-Shaped Mirror Glaze Cake On White Marble Pedestal With Silver Server &Amp; White Rose Petal. Elegant Dessert For Celebrations.

Pin this show-stopping dessert to your “Fancy Valentine’s Baking” board!

Supplies Needed

  • High-quality food coloring (gel or liquid, preferably red or pink)
  • Neutral mirror glaze mix or ingredients (gelatin sheets, glucose, condensed milk)
  • Heart shaped cake silicone molds
  • Offset spatula for spreading glaze base
  • Digital thermometer (crucial for proper glazing temperature)

Instructions

  1. Prepare and fully chill your heart-shaped sponge or mousse cake base (layer cakes).
  2. Assemble and prepare the mirror glaze mixture, ensuring the temperature is exactly between 90-95°F (32-35°C) to achieve a flawless aesthetic finish.
  3. Position the chilled cake on a wire rack over a baking sheet to catch excess glaze.
  4. Pour the glaze quickly and evenly over the top, using the offset spatula to lightly guide any missing areas.
  5. Allow excess glaze to drip off before carefully transferring the glossy cake to a serving platter.
  6. Decorate only after the glaze has set with minimal edible paint applications for details or tiny edible pearls.

Pro-Tip: To prevent micro-bubbles (which ruin the mirror aesthetic), cover the glaze container with plastic wrap, pressing it directly against the surface before chilling, and stir very gently during the final warming stage. This ensures a flawless, patisserie-level aesthetic baking result.

2. Form Ruby Chocolate Truffles with Edible Dust

Handmade Ruby Chocolate Truffles With Gold Dust, Pink/Crimson Hues, On Vintage Lace Doily With Silver Spoon. Gourmet Dessert.

Double-tap this image if ruby chocolate is your favorite aesthetic treat!

Ingredients

  • High-quality ruby chocolate callets (specific cocoa content recommended)
  • Heavy cream (minimum 35% fat)
  • Vanilla extract or raspberry liqueur for infusing flavors
  • Edible metallic dust (gold or rose gold)
  • Unsweetened cocoa powder for coating

Instructions

  1. Chop the ruby chocolate finely and place it in a heatproof bowl.
  2. Bring the heavy cream and flavorings to a simmer, then pour immediately over the chocolate.
  3. Allow to sit for 5 minutes, then stir gently until a smooth, decadent ganache is formed.
  4. Chill the ganache for at least 4 hours, or until firm enough to roll.
  5. Use a small scoop to form truffles and roll quickly between your palms (form truffles).
  6. Dust the finished truffles lightly with cocoa powder or use a small brush to apply the edible metallic dust for an elegant V-Day bake aesthetic.
  7. Package gifts immediately in small dessert boxes.

Pro-Tip: To enhance the visual appeal, dip half the truffle in tempered white chocolate and then dust the ruby section. Use a food-safe brush to apply the metallic dust only after the chocolate has fully set for a clean finish.

3. Pipe Rose Water Macarons with Pistachio Buttercream

Delicate Light Pink French Macarons With Pistachio Buttercream &Amp; Rosebud On White Plate. Gourmet Dessert With Rose Water.

Pin this elegant sweet creation to save this challenging but beautiful recipe!

Ingredients

  • Almond flour, finely sifted (ensure no clumps)
  • Granulated sugar and powdered sugar
  • Egg whites, aged (crucial for structure)
  • Rose water extract (natural, high-quality)
  • Green food coloring (small amount for pistachio buttercream)
  • High-quality pistachios, shelled and ground

Instructions

  1. Prepare the macaron batter using the Italian or Swiss method, mastering the ‘macaronage’ technique (mix ingredients) to achieve a slow, ribbon-like flow.
  2. Transfer the batter to a piping bag fitted with a round tip (pipe designs).
  3. Pipe small, uniform circles onto a silicone baking mat. Slam the trays several times to release air bubbles (techniques that ensure success).
  4. Allow the piped shells to dry (develop a skin) for 30–60 minutes before baking.
  5. Prepare the pistachio buttercream, ensuring a smooth, stable consistency for filling.
  6. Once shells are cool, match sizes and pipe the filling onto one shell, gently sandwiching the other on top.

Pro-Tip: Achieve a vibrant, high-end dessert aesthetic by using edible paint applications for tiny metallic accents on the macaron shells after they have cooled completely.

5. Prepare Dark Chocolate Tart with Elegant Gold Leaf

Decadent Dark Chocolate Tart With Glossy Filling &Amp; Edible Gold Leaf On Black Stone. Elegant Dessert With Silver Fork.

Save this image for the ultimate sophisticated Valentine’s dessert design!

Ingredients

  • High-quality dark chocolate (70% cocoa or higher for richness)
  • Heavy cream
  • Unsalted butter
  • Pre-made shortcrust pastry or ingredients for homemade basic pastry dough
  • Edible gold leaf sheets
  • 9-inch tart pan with removable bottom

Instructions

  1. Prepare and pre-bake (blind bake) the tart crust shell (bake pies, repurposed for tart shell) until golden and set.
  2. Prepare the chocolate ganache filling: heat cream until simmering and pour over chopped chocolate and butter (prepare fillings). Whisk until silky smooth.
  3. Pour the ganache into the cooled tart shell and chill for at least 6 hours, or until completely set.
  4. Carefully apply edible gold leaf using a specialized brush or tweezers (decorate aesthetic treats).
  5. Garnish desserts with a dusting of cocoa or sea salt flakes just before serving.

Pro-Tip: The key to the tart’s aesthetic is preventing the filling from cracking. Ensure the ganache is allowed to cool slightly before pouring, and chill it slowly in the refrigerator (not the freezer).

8. Decorate Sugar Cookies with Flooding Technique

Decorated Heart-Shaped Sugar Cookies With White, Pink, Red Royal Icing &Amp; Intricate Designs. Sweet Valentine's Dessert.

Pin these simple Valentine’s Day cookie decorating ideas for later!

Supplies Needed

  • Fully baked sugar cookies (pre-cut into heart shapes)
  • Royal icing mix or ingredients (meringue powder, powdered sugar)
  • Gel food coloring (pink and red)
  • Piping bags and fine-tipped round piping tips
  • Squeeze bottles for flooding icing
  • Toothpicks or fine piping tool (for detail work)

Instructions

  1. Prepare two consistencies of royal icing: a thick ‘outline’ consistency and a thinner ‘flood’ consistency.
  2. Use the thick icing and a fine tip to outline the perimeter of the heart-shaped cookies (pipe designs). Allow to dry for 10-15 minutes.
  3. Use the thinner icing in a squeeze bottle to fill (flood) the outlined area (glaze treats). Use the toothpick to gently spread the icing to the edges.
  4. For wet-on-wet aesthetic, immediately drop small dots of contrasting icing colors onto the wet flood layer and swirl gently with the toothpick.
  5. Allow cookies to dry completely (up to 8 hours) before stacking or packaging.

Pro-Tip: To get the perfect smooth, glossy surface (key to the aesthetic), hold the squeeze bottle 1-2 inches above the cookie when flooding. This allows the icing to settle smoothly without lines, resulting in a beautifully decorated finish.

10. Dip Strawberries in Chocolate with Aesthetic Drizzle

Ripe Strawberries Coated In Milk &Amp; White Chocolate With Drizzles, On Parchment. Gourmet Chocolate Fruit Dessert.

Pin this incredibly easy and romantic baking idea now!

Ingredients

  • Large, ripe strawberries (thoroughly washed and dried)
  • High-quality dipping chocolate (milk, white, or dark)
  • Cocoa butter or shortening (optional, for thinning)
  • Piping bags or parchment paper cones for drizzling
  • Optional: Edible glitter or finely chopped nuts for texture

Instructions

  1. Wash and, most critically, ensure the strawberries are completely dry before starting (techniques that ensure success). Any moisture will cause the chocolate to seize.
  2. Melt chocolate (melt chocolate) using a double boiler or chocolate melting pot to the correct temperature for dipping (coat strawberries).
  3. Dip each strawberry fully into the melted chocolate, tilting the bowl for full coverage.
  4. Place the dipped berries onto parchment paper to set.
  5. Melt a contrasting color chocolate and drizzle it over the set berries using a small piping bag or a fork for a sophisticated aesthetic pattern.
  6. Allow chocolate to fully harden before handling or packaging.

Pro-Tip: Use a small amount of refined coconut oil or cocoa butter to thin the melted chocolate slightly. This ensures a smoother coating and a thinner shell, greatly enhancing the elegant visual appeal.
